Veal Fricassee
Pale ragout of poached veal with asparagus, peas and mushrooms in a light sauce enriched with egg yolk.

Ingredients · for 4 servings
700 g veal (shoulder)
1 onion
1 carrot
500 g white asparagus
150 g peas
200 g mushrooms
40 g butter
40 g flour
150 ml cream
1 egg yolk
1 lemon
Salt, pepper
Instructions
- Cut the veal into 3 cm cubes, place in a pot with the halved onion and the roughly cut carrot in 1.2 l lightly salted water and simmer gently covered for 50 min. until tender.
- Peel the asparagus, cut into 4 cm pieces and add to the broth for the last quarter hour, then lift out the meat and asparagus and strain the broth through a sieve.
- Quarter the mushrooms and sauté in a dry pan for 4 min. until the liquid has evaporated.
- Melt butter in a pot, stir in the flour and cook for 2 min. until lightly toasted, then gradually whisk in 600 ml of the hot veal broth and let the sauce simmer gently for 10 min.
- Add the meat, asparagus, mushrooms and peas and let everything gently heat through for 5 min.
- Whisk the egg yolk with the cream, remove the pot from the heat, stir in the liaison, season with salt, pepper and the juice of half a lemon, and serve with rice.
